Output 30bb0668236fc7e79f4928268c2ed350bbb9f31f143115bd39686e9103368e7a:0

value
253886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25aa5528a2d73efd57bd3a1a3fce5926ea863db6 OP_EQUALVERIFY OP_CHECKSIG
address
14SA422wbcXYLumQKyxuj89ZuBf1J3z8HB
transaction
30bb0668236fc7e79f4928268c2ed350bbb9f31f143115bd39686e9103368e7a
spent
true